Influence of Sunshine Strength



Occasionally, the strength of sunshine can substantially impact the efficiency of solar panels. When the sunshine is strong and straight, your photovoltaic panels produce even more electrical power. However, throughout over cast days or when the sunlight is at a low angle, the panels get much less sunshine, minimizing their efficiency. To make best use of the power outcome of your photovoltaic panels, it's vital to install them in locations with sufficient sunshine exposure throughout the day. Think about factors like shielding from neighboring trees or buildings that can block sunlight and reduce the panels' efficiency.

Influence of Temperature Level Adjustments



When temperature adjustments take place, they can have a significant effect on the efficiency of photovoltaic panels. Photovoltaic panel work finest in cooler temperature levels, making them much more reliable on light days compared to very warm ones. As the temperature increases, photovoltaic panels can experience a decline in effectiveness because of a sensation called the temperature coefficient. This impact creates a reduction in voltage result, ultimately impacting the general power production of the panels.

Role of Cloud Cover and Rain



Cloud cover and rains can dramatically impact the effectiveness of photovoltaic panels. When clouds block the sun, the quantity of sunshine reaching your solar panels is minimized, bring about a reduction in power manufacturing. Rainfall can likewise impact solar panel effectiveness by blocking sunshine and creating a layer of dirt or grime on the panels, better decreasing their capacity to produce electrical power. Even light rain can spread sunlight, creating it to be much less concentrated on the panels.



Throughout cloudy days with hefty cloud cover, solar panels may experience a considerable decrease in power output. However, it's worth noting that some contemporary photovoltaic panel modern technologies can still generate electrical energy even when the sky is gloomy. In addition, rain can have a cleaning impact on photovoltaic panels, getting rid of dirt and dirt that may have collected gradually.
